Interface ICfnLocationFSxONTAPProps
Properties for defining a CfnLocationFSxONTAP
.
Namespace: Amazon.CDK.AWS.DataSync
Assembly: Amazon.CDK.AWS.DataSync.dll
Syntax (csharp)
public interface ICfnLocationFSxONTAPProps
Syntax (vb)
Public Interface ICfnLocationFSxONTAPProps

Examples
// The code below shows an example of how to instantiate this type.
// The values are placeholders you should change.
using Amazon.CDK.AWS.DataSync;
var cfnLocationFSxONTAPProps = new CfnLocationFSxONTAPProps {
SecurityGroupArns = new [] { "securityGroupArns" },
StorageVirtualMachineArn = "storageVirtualMachineArn",
// the properties below are optional
Protocol = new ProtocolProperty {
Nfs = new NFSProperty {
MountOptions = new NfsMountOptionsProperty {
Version = "version"
}
},
Smb = new SMBProperty {
MountOptions = new SmbMountOptionsProperty {
Version = "version"
},
Password = "password",
User = "user",
// the properties below are optional
Domain = "domain"
}
},
Subdirectory = "subdirectory",
Tags = new [] { new CfnTag {
Key = "key",
Value = "value"
} }
};

SecurityGroupArns
Specifies the Amazon Resource Names (ARNs) of the security groups that DataSync can use to access your FSx for ONTAP file system.
string[] SecurityGroupArns { get; }
Property Value
System.String[]
Remarks
You must configure the security groups to allow outbound traffic on the following ports (depending on the protocol that you're using):
Your file system's security groups must also allow inbound traffic on the same port.

Subdirectory
Specifies a path to the file share in the SVM where you'll copy your data.
virtual string Subdirectory { get; }
Property Value
System.String
Remarks
You can specify a junction path (also known as a mount point), qtree path (for NFS file shares), or share name (for SMB file shares). For example, your mount path might be /vol1
, /vol1/tree1
, or /share1
.
Don't specify a junction path in the SVM's root volume. For more information, see Managing FSx for ONTAP storage virtual machines in the Amazon FSx for NetApp ONTAP User Guide .
